Now a new experiment to fix the quasi-dead SLFI blockchain.  A large amount of SLFI coins was chopped into thousands of small coins, deposit into thousands of addresses in a wallet.

The hope was that there are so many different chunk of coins in a wallet that I control  So coin age may kick one chunk into 8 hours of maturing, the other chunks should keep going and generate blocks for SLFI blockchain.  

Not sure this experiment will salvage the almost-dead blockchain or not. Let's see.

Checked today's 7 transactions block reward, total of 21.7 million SLFI.  Economics of SLFI does not look good. Currently there are 5 billion SLFI on the info from wallet.  The mining reward total is more than current total of supply there per year. So much inflation, plus with wallet concentration, no decentralization issue.  Heavy CPU usage when wallet is chopped into small chunks. Ton of issue.

Delisting Notification on Selfiecoin (SLFI) from ShorelineCrypto Exchange
4/27/2021

Selfiecoin(SLFI) will be delisted from ShorelineCrypto exchange on May 5, 2021.  The last trading day for Selfiecoin (SLFI)  is 04/30/2021.  After that up until 05/5/2021, SLFI will be allowed to withdraw only, and trading disabled.

On May 5,  2021, SLFI will be delisted and removed from exchange.  Please withdraw all your Selfiecoin (SLFI) balances to your private Selfiecoin (SLFI) wallet before SLFI delisting day.

The decision on delisting is based on technical determination that Selfiecoin network is extremely unstable and not functional.  This happened previously before with delisting warning from exchange on 10/30/2020.  So far no Selfiecoin dev has come forward recently on this coin for technical rescue and it was abandoned by dev obviously.

Note that we will facilitate withdrawal of all SLFI from exchange as much as possible before delisting day. Due to technical non-functional coin blockchain, we expect that our existing SLFI exchange holders are unlikely to smoothly withdraw SLFI  in all or in part.  Treat your SLFI at exchange as donation to exchange if you are unable to withdraw SLFI from exchange before delisting day.
